Kohima: Easter H Yepthomi, a retainer lawyer for the Zunheboto District Legal Services Authority, addressed the public during an event marking World No Tobacco Day on May 31. The program took place at the Old Town Prayer Fellowship in Zunheboto.
During the session, Yepthomi focused on the legal aspects of tobacco control, specifically highlighting key provisions of the Cigarettes and Other Tobacco Products Act. The presentation aimed to educate attendees on the regulations surrounding tobacco usage and the legal framework designed to curb its impact on public health.
